Viviana Mitre’s mother and grandmother always wanted to attend college—but the challenges and pressures of life in Juárez, Mexico, thwarted their ambitions.

Viviana was determined to surmount these barriers and pursue higher education.

Every day, for 10 years, she drove across the border to earn bachelor’s and master’s degrees at the University of Texas at El Paso.
